

The First Squad reports the arrest of a North Merrick couple for Narcotics that occurred on Tuesday, March 12, 2019, at 6:15 P.M in North Merrick.
According to Detectives, First Precinct Police with the assistance of the Nassau County Probation Department conducted a night watch probation check at a North Merrick residence located at 1285 Meadowbrook road. While inside the residence conducting a lawful search of the defendants, Kenneth Riggio 59, Faith Riggio 53, officers recovered in excess of 200 Oxycodone tablets, numerous Xanax tablets, eight clear bags containing a white powdery substance believed to be cocaine, and a switchblade knife. Both defendants were placed into Police custody. A further search of the home revealed large amounts of U.S currency and a brown/tan powdery substance believed to be heroin.
Kenneth Riggio is charged with 3 counts of criminal possession of a controlled substance 3rd degree with intent to sell, 1 count of criminal possession of a controlled substance 3rd degree, 11 counts of criminal possession of a controlled substance 7th degree, criminal possession of a weapon 3rd degree. Faith Riggio is charged with 1 count of criminal possession of a controlled substance 5th degree. Both defendants will be arraigned Thursday March 14th 2019 at First District Court in Hempstead.
